Bengaluru: The state government has banned civil servants from issuing a press statement and approaching the court on the government’s decision without the permission of the authorities concerned.
Head of Secretary P Ravi Kumar issued an order in this case on Saturday.
The order came two days after the JD HD Kumaraswamy leader and former Minister of SA RA Mahesh urged the government to control the bureaucrats who talked against legislators and fellow officers.
Keep in mind that Mahesh and then Mysuru DC Rohini Sindhuri locked the horn in public above the pool built on DC’s residence.
Both have published statements with each other in the media.
“Officers must talk to the media only related to their respective departmental programs and it is also absolutely necessary,” said the command.
The order also prohibits officials from the use of their personal social media to tell people about their department program.
